Pair Trading with National Vision and Sally Beauty
The main advantage of trading using opposite National Vision and Sally Beauty posit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if National Vision position performs unexpectedly, Sally Beauty can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Sally Beauty will offset losses from the drop in Sally Beauty's long position.The idea behind National Vision Holdings and Sally Beauty Holdings p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
